Now the AndroidManifest.xml file should look like this: Replace the value "YOUR KEY HERE" with an API key you created. To be able to use the Google Maps inside the app via the API key you created in the previous section, you’ll have to copy and paste as per the instructions below.įirst, open your Flutter project and navigate to the file at this location: android/app/src/main/AndroidManifest.xml. ![]() If it were just for the map, you’d select Maps API from the listĪdding Google Maps in Flutter app (Android) API restrictions enable you to select which services are accessible using this key.You can select the appropriate option to make sure the key you created works only for that specific platform Application restrictions enable you to define which type of app should have access to this key (i.e., Android or iOS).For example, if you’re willing to use the API keys just for a map, then you should allow it to be used by the Maps service only. If you’re targeting both platforms, you should obtain two API keys so that you can track them better.Īfter creating the API keys, I would highly recommend implementing some restrictions. Click on the Credentials menu on the left.Therefore, you must create a set of API keys for it and restrict its permissions to reduce the chances of unauthorized usage. It is important to note that the access to the Google Map APIs is not free. ![]() Click Maps SDK for Android and then click Enable.Click Maps SDK for iOS and then click Enable.Once the project is created, you’ll have to enable the Maps API SDK for both Android and iOS. ![]() Head to the Google Developers Console and click the already-selected project.Ĭlick on the current project name again and you should see your new project created in the list. This is required because you’ll need APIs to integrate Google Maps in your app. The very first step is to create a project at Google Developers Console. Modifying your maps with the GoogleMap widgetĬreating a project in Google Cloud Platform.Adding Google Maps in Flutter (Android).Creating a project in Google Cloud Platform.In this tutorial, we’ll show you how to use the official plugin for integrating Google Maps in your Flutter app. We use it for everything from finding directions to a destination, to searching for a nearby restaurant or gas station, to just zooming in and out of the map to see the street view of any location on the planet.Īdding Google Maps to your mobile app can open up a whole new world to your users - literally. I can’t imagine what life would be like without Google Maps. Using Google Maps to add maps in Flutter applicationsĮditor’s note: This post was updated on 23 September 2022. Over the last seven-plus years, I've been developing and leading various mobile apps in different areas. I hope you enjoyed this sneak peak in my last Friday night :).Pinkesh Darji Follow I love to solve problems using technology that improves users' lives on a major scale. It's not the most beautiful ever, as it is meant to run only once. You can see the file here (Careful though, the file is 300Mb big, there are a lot of screenshots in there!). That will help further find which Sentinel data and locations I want to look into first. There are only 324 results so a great simple tool like lowdb will do wonders.Īnd to make browsing easy, I have added a very crude index.html file that shows up al data gathered. The code is insanely concise though: const puppeteer = require('puppeteer') Ĭonst STORE_LINK_SELECTOR = ".k4-storelist-sublist-link"Ĭonst browser = await puppeteer.launch(/` įinally, I have coupled all those results in a database. ![]() I first tried simply with BeautifulSoup, and (Selenium - Web Browser Automation) but the website returned errors. The main idea is to check the list and extract the shop name as well as its location (coming from the Google Maps link). Luckily, the main website itself has us covered. The first thing to do was to gather all carrefour locations in a database. It was the perfect use case to start playing around with Puppeteer, a Headless Chrome Node API I heard about for the first time at the Polymer Summit in Copenhagen last year. One of my ideas was to check how many of the largest Carrefours in France has open parking lots in France. Over the last weeks, I have been reading quite a bit about Geomarketing and have been searching for fun experiements to do.
0 Comments
Leave a Reply. |